Serologic Diagnosis of Celiac Disease
- Tissue transglutaminase IgA (TTG IgA) testing is 95% sensitive and specific for celiac but requires normal total IgA.
- European guidelines sometimes allow serologic diagnosis without endoscopy when TTG exceeds 10 times normal.
Endoscopy Timing in Celiac Diagnosis
- Ensure patients undergo endoscopy for celiac diagnosis while still consuming gluten to avoid false negative biopsies.
- Biopsies focus on the duodenal bulb area during upper endoscopy for diagnosis.
Risks of Untreated Active Celiac
- Persistent active celiac disease risks poor growth, bone fractures, and small bowel malignancies like lymphoma.
- Symptoms like frequent bone fractures and growth faltering should raise suspicion for celiac.
